GaTechGal wrote:This young women said that even if she was beat up, she just has to go along with it. "That's part of the Disney integrity. We have to." she said. Is this TRUE???
As 2 other posters have stated, no, CMs do not have to & should not subject themselves to any type of abuse! I learned this the hard way - twice. After each incident DL Security came to me, sat me down & firmly told me I was never ever to let a guest abuse me in any way. Bottom line - "You have an abusive guest, call us, then walk." Pays to know a few DL Security officers. :) I've since only walked out of my location once for protection. Made sure my cash wrap was covered then walked away. Felt great!
